Police: Bohemia Man Arrested After Drugs, Paraphernalia Found In Car

The arrest was made last Friday, Oct. 31.

East Hampton Village Police arrested a 35-year-old Bohemia man who was found with drugs and drug paraphernalia in his car on Friday, Oct. 31.

Police pulled over the man who was driving on Montauk Highway and Cove Hollow Road after he was observed speeding, swerving and driving on the shoulder.

A DMV check showed that he had a suspended license due to failure to answer a summons, according police.

A further investigation found a spoon, a tourniquet, a metal rod and four hypodermic needles, one loaded with a substance located in a sunglass case on the driver side door.

Police tested the substance using a Narc II kit, which tested positive for heroin.

The man was arrested for criminal possession of a controlled substance in the seventh degree, criminal possession of a hypodermic instrument and aggravated unlicensed operation in the third degree.

He was released on cash bail and an appearance ticket.
